Sir Peter Lely (1618-1680) was Charles II’s Principal Painter and the outstanding artistic figure of Restoration England. When Lely arrived in England in the early 1640s his ambition was to be a painter of narrative scenes and not to work as a portraitist.

As an American living in England, a conscious Jew who utilized Christian symbols, a skillful modeler who introduced direct carving into England, Epstein did not fit neatly into the artistic categories of his time.
